Lunchtime supervisor
Posted: 16h ago
Offer description

We can offer you:Amazing children and families to work alongsideA caring and supportive working environment that prioritises well-beingThe opportunity for progression and CPD within the federationSupportive and friendly teamCompetitive salary and generous annual leave entitlementA generous Local Government pension schemeDiscounted nursery sessions for your childrenOnsite parking and free tea and coffee!In return for:Supervising children during the lunch and break periods. Ensuring the security and care of children of the nursery school and to promote their social development during the lunch period. The hours for this role are 11.15am - 1.15pm, 5 days per week term time only (39 weeks per year)The actual salary is £5,764 - £5,854Responsibilities and Accountabilities:Support all children to engage with lunch time routines, being able to sit with their peers and develop self-help skills with eating their prepacked lunch. Supervise children, during the lunch periods, playground areas and nursery school premises, ensuring the safety, welfare, physical and mental well-being of children. To support children in developing self-control and respect as part of a wider group, following the schools Behaviour and Relationships policy in promoting restorative practices. Report any unwanted behaviours to senior leadership team and follow any individual care or behaviour support plans. Ensure the safety and wellbeing of children, providing emotional support where necessary. Arrange and supervise the provision and experiences. Using your knowledge of food hygiene practices and allergy awareness, ensure the children are kept safe following the schools' policies for food hygiene. Ensure that all children who suffer any injury or accident are dealt with appropriately following the school's agreed procedures. (Call for first aid assistance as necessary)Support for School/ Place of work:Assist with the setting up and clearing of the lunchtime provision e.g. tables, chairs, waste bins etc. Promoting and ensuring good behaviour and calm atmosphere including dealing with unwanted behaviours in accordance with the federations behaviour policy. To assist children with cutting up food, opening tubs, pouring water etc. where appropriate to e.g. age of child, needs of child, as necessary. Addressing issues calmly and politely and in doing so being a role model to the children Develop and maintain effective working relationships with other staff and parents/carers. To encourage social skills and good table manners, ensuring safety with knives and forks. To clean up spillages of food and to organise clearing cutlery and crockery off tables. Adhere to the Federation values. Follow school policies, practices and procedures. Data security:Act in accordance with legal provisions regulating confidentiality and security of data and information in accordance with GDPR regulations. Health and Safety: Be aware of the responsibility for personal Health, Safety and Welfare and that of others who may be affected by your actions or inactions. Be aware of and support pupils with medical/dietary needs Co-operate with the school on all issues to do with Health, Safety & Welfare. To work/operate all equipment within Health and Safety and other legal regulations, including risk assessments. Physically able to perform tasks set out in this job description. Contribute to the maintenance of a safe and healthy environment. Continuing Professional Development:In conjunction with the line manager, take responsibility for personal professional development, keeping up to date with research and developments related to school/place of work efficiency, which may lead to improvements in the day-to-day running of the nursery school. Undertake any necessary and identified professional development taking full advantage of any relevant training and development available, particularly when related to the use of ICT, for data management and record keeping. Maintain a professional portfolio of evidence to support the Performance Management process - evaluating and improving own practice. Child Protection and SafeguardingThe post holder will have a shared responsibility for the safeguarding of all children and young people. The post holder also has an implicit duty to promote the welfare of all children and young people. To inform the Designated Safeguarding Lead of any issues relating to the safety and well-being of children. The Foundation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and expects all staff and volunteers to share in this commitment. All staff will be subject to an enhanced check with the Disclosure & Barring Service.
